Fmvss 120/part 567/incorrect information on labels
Defect Summary
Triumph is recalling 356 my 2008 rocket iii touring motorcycles for failing to comply with the requirements of federal motor vehicle safety standard no. 120, "tire selection and rims for motor vehicles other than passenger cars," and part 567, "certification." the certification label, located on the left front frame tube, includes incorrect information regarding tire sizes and pressures, as well as an incorrect gross vehicle weight rating (gvwr).
Safety Consequence
An owner may under-inflate the front tire if using the incorrect information. under-inflation may cause a tire to slip or come off the rim causing a loss of control which could result in a crash.
Corrective Action
Dealers will install a new certification label. the recall began on april 23, 2008. owners may contact triumph at 1-678-539-8782.

What is recall 08V145000?
NHTSA recall 08V145000 was issued by Triumph Motorcycles America, Ltd. on March 26, 2008. It addresses: Fmvss 120/part 567/incorrect information on labels. The recall affects approximately 356 vehicles, with the defect involving the Equipment component.
How do I get this recall repaired?
Contact any authorized Triumph Motorcycles America, Ltd. dealer and reference NHTSA recall ID 08V145000 or the manufacturer campaign number 392. Under federal law, the repair is completely free regardless of vehicle age or owner history.
Is my vehicle included in this recall?
The only way to confirm is to look up your 17-character VIN at nhtsa.gov/recalls. NHTSA's tool will tell you if VIN-by-VIN this exact recall applies.
How long do I have to get a recall repair done?
There is no expiration on most federal safety recalls. Even if your vehicle is years old and you bought it used, the manufacturer is required to perform the repair at no cost.
